NNIE Riddle is usually complaining about decisions affecting us in the south of the county being made “remotely” in Trowbridge.
However, in a sudden about-turn, she now complains that decisions about youth services are to be made locally by our area boards.
She can’t have it both ways.
Does she support local decision-making or not? If so, why can’t she bring herself to applaud Wiltshire Council’s brave move to devolve decisions on youth activities – and accompanying budgets – to locally-elected councillors?
Cllr Richard Britton Alderbury
